Chica, do some research and connect with
the TG community in your area. There
might be a doctor who specializes in it.
DO GET A DOCTOR. Especially for the first
few years you need to have your blood
monitored so that a safe dosage and be
prescribed. If you were here in NYC I would
recommend Callen-Lorde as much because it's
inexpensive as for the fact that they have a
couple of doctors who specialize in TG.
Once you have your Rx then you can purchase
the same medicine from online sources if you
need it less expensive but still best to follow
the dosages that the doctor suggests. IMHO

"My blood is fine, as i'm a healthy person"
What does that have to do with it?
You need to get your blood tested every 3 months
for the first year or so to see how you are metabolizing the hormones. To make sure that you continue to be healthy.
What doctor says "thanks for the interview, i'll get back to you" ?!?!
Find another doctor. Do some research and find a doctor that has a good reputation in the TG community.
